BPKF supports research and educational activities in Nepal and also finances visits and exchanges between India and Nepal of scholars, poets, writers, journalists, artists, teachers, instructors, professors and other professional both in general field of education and in the field of agriculture, public health, science and technology and such other fields. The foundation has been also financing programmes and activities such as seminars, symposia, colloquia, workshops etc on subjects of common interest since its establishment. Issues regarding child development, women empowerment, conservation of cultural heritage and traditional crafts have been addressed. The foundation has been contributing towards publication of standard works in the field of Nepalese history and culture. The Foundation encourages the translation of standard works of Nepalese literature into Indian languages and vice-versa and arranging for their publication.
